#dcb7ab color RGB value is (220,183,171). #dcb7ab color name is Custom Color color.

#dcb7ab hex color red value is 220, green value is 183 and the blue value of its RGB is 171.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#dcb7ab hue: 0.04, saturation: 0.41 and the lightness value of dcb7ab is 0.77.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#dcb7ab color hex is 0.00, 0.17, 0.22, 0.14. Web safe color of #dcb7ab is #cccc99. Color #dcb7ab contains mainly ORANGE color.

About #DCB7AB Custom Color

#DCB7AB (Custom Color) is a orange-based color with RGB values of 220, 183, 171. This color belongs to the orange color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#dcb7ab,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#dcb7ab can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#dcb7ab), RGB (rgb(220, 183, 171)), HSL (hsl(15, 41%, 77%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#cccc99,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
